About

The Afterglow of Grisaia, released in 2015, is a visual novel that serves as a captivating side story to The Labyrinth of Grisaia. This PC game delves into the past of protagonist Kazami Yuuji, shedding light on his early life with Kusakabe Asako, the CIRS agent who rescued him from a terrorist organization. Notable for its rich storytelling and character development, the game offers a unique blend of drama and suspense that keeps players engaged through its narrative twists and character interactions.

Performance profile

Released in December 2015, The Afterglow of Grisaia sits in the DirectX 11 generation. Comfortable on any modern mid-range GPU at 1440p; even an RTX 3050 or RX 6600 typically delivers 4K60 at High settings.

Extremely light — The Afterglow of Grisaia runs at 60 FPS 1080p on any integrated GPU (Intel Iris Xe, AMD Radeon Graphics) or a decade-old discrete card like the GTX 1050. A current-gen RTX 4060 pushes 4K Ultra without effort.
